Let's solve this Grade 1 Verbs Worksheet step by step. The goal is to choose the correct verb from the given list to complete each sentence.

Given Verbs to Choose From:


- sitting
- chases
- pick
- eat
- mixes
- came
- walk
- told
- looks
- reads

---

Sentence-by-Sentence Analysis:



---

1) The cat _________ the mouse.

- Cats often chase mice.
- "Chases" is the correct verb here (present tense, singular subject).
Answer: chases

---

2) The painter _________ the colors.

- Painters mix colors.
- "Mixes" matches the singular subject "painter".
Answer: mixes

---

3) The children _________ to the park.

- Children go to the park by walking or coming, but "walk" is a common verb for movement.
- "Walk" is plural (children), so it fits.
Answer: walk

> Note: "came" could also work, but "walk" is more general and fits better with the idea of going to the park.

---

4) The slide _________ slippery.

- This describes a state — what the slide looks like.
- "Looks" is used to describe appearance.
Answer: looks

---

5) The teacher _________ the class a story.

- Teachers read stories to students.
- "Reads" is the present tense for a singular subject.
Answer: reads

---

6) Mom _________ the kids to _________ up their toys.

- Mom told them to do something.
- Then, the kids should pick up their toys.
- So: "Mom told the kids to pick up their toys."
Answers: told, pick

---

7) My friend _________ to my house after school.

- "Came" is the past tense of "come", which fits well in a past event.
- "Came" is correct for a singular subject.
Answer: came

---

8) Cathy and Emily _________ apple pie while _________ at the table.

- Two people are eating and sitting.
- They eat apple pie (plural subject → "eat").
- While they are sitting at the table.
- So: "Cathy and Emily eat apple pie while sitting at the table."

Answers: eat, sitting

---

Final Answers:



1) The cat chases the mouse.
2) The painter mixes the colors.
3) The children walk to the park.
4) The slide looks slippery.
5) The teacher reads the class a story.
6) Mom told the kids to pick up their toys.
7) My friend came to my house after school.
8) Cathy and Emily eat apple pie while sitting at the table.

---

Summary of Verb Usage:


- Action verbs: chases, mixes, walk, read, pick, eat
- State/observation verbs: looks
- Reporting verbs: told
- Past tense: came

This worksheet helps build understanding of verb forms and subject-verb agreement in simple sentences.
